Former New Zealand cricketer Scott Styris believes that India’s top-order batsman KL Rahul has a chance to shine for his team because Pakistan pace bowler Shaheen Shah Afridi would not be present at the upcoming Asia Cup.

Due to a knee injury, Shaheen Afridi was pulled out of Pakistan’s team for the flagship event. The 22-year-old sustained the injury during the recent Test series in Galle against Sri Lanka.

KL Rahul made his first appearance since the end of the 2022 Indian Premier League. He was scheduled to lead India during the five-match T20I series against South Africa but was forced to withdraw just before the start of the series owing to an injury for which he traveled to Germany for surgery.

When Rahul tested positive for Covid-19 before the T20I series against the West Indies, his return was further delayed. Eventually, he made a comeback and guided India to a three-match ODI series victory over Zimbabwe. He had trouble with the bat, though, as seen by his scores of 1 and 30 in the second and third games in Harare.

Scott Styris analyzes KL Rahul’s form ahead of the Asia Cup:

KL Rahul’s performance in the lead-up to the Asia Cup 2022 is not a major issue for Scott Styris, who anticipates that the Indian vice-captain will soon return to form.

“First off, I would not be concerned either about KL Rahul. If he faced 5–10 balls per innings, I would be concerned, but the last one in particular—46 deliveries, I believe—made me nervous.”

“If that is the case, it indicates that the middle of the game is approaching and that he will become increasingly fluent. Much more priceless than the nets” Scott Styris said.

“The absence of the primary man who exposes the weakness. I believe KL Rahul still has a chance to be the star that we know he is, because, as Saba correctly pointed out, the lineage is there” Scott Styris stated during an interview on the SPORTS18 program “SPORTS OVER THE TOP.”

In the ODI series against Zimbabwe, Rahul amassed 31 runs throughout two innings. Despite scoring 30 runs in the game’s last innings, he was not at his best and was dismissed just as he was beginning to attack the opposing bowlers.
